ADVANCED CONFIGURATION SERVICE MENUS  
CONFIGURE SERVICE MENUS  
The following Service Menus (SM) commonly require configuration. Please verify that  
these are set for your specific application. Additional configuration may be required.  
SM 100 = Programmable or Nonprogrammable  
SM 110 = System Type  
SM 112 = Fan Type  
SM 135 = W1 Heat Output NO or NC  
SM 170 = Remote Sensors  
SM 240 = Number of Programmable Events per Day  
SM 395 = Override Duration for Programmable Operation  
SM 340 = Keypad Lock Out

SERVICE MENU ACCESS  
1. Hold lower right and lower left keys for five seconds.  
2. Press Next or Go Back button to select a Service Menu.  
3. Press ▲/ ▼ to select option.  
4. Press Done when complete.
